A systematic review and meta-analysis show a decreasing prevalence of post-stroke infections

Post-stroke infections have declined significantly, with pneumonia being the most common. Europe and Africa show the highest infection rates, highlighting areas for targeted prevention and control strategies.

Background:

  • Post-stroke infections are a significant complication, with previous reviews reporting up to 30% prevalence.
  • A comprehensive synthesis of current data is needed to guide prevention and management strategies.
  • This systematic review addresses the gap by detailing the epidemiology, global prevalence, and mortality rates of post-stroke infections.

Approach:

  • A systematic review was conducted using data from 2210 studies.
  • 73 studies, encompassing over 32 million stroke patients, were included in the final analysis.
  • Prevalence data were extracted and analyzed using RStudio version 4.3.3.

Key Points:

  • The pooled prevalence of post-stroke infections is 9.14%, with a mortality rate of 15.91%.
  • Pneumonia (12.4%) and urinary tract infections (8.31%) are the most prevalent infections.
  • Prevalence varies geographically, with Europe (10.41%) and Africa (10.22%) having the highest rates.

Conclusions:

  • Global post-stroke infection prevalence has decreased approximately threefold in the past decade.
  • Pneumonia remains the most frequent post-stroke infection.
  • Higher infection prevalence in Europe and Africa necessitates focused public health interventions.
